Hiroshi Daimon (大門 宏, Daimon Hiroshi; born 16 February 1962) is a Japanese former cyclist, who currently works as a directeur sportif for UCI Continental team EF Education–Nippo Development Team.[2] He competed in the men's point race at the 1992 Summer Olympics.[3] During his career, he rode for European teams before joining Nippo Hodō in 1991.[4]
